General Notes: Husband - William Cameron

South Strabane Twp, Washington Co, PA

After marriage, he and his wife settled on a place of twenty-one acres, to which they added over 200 acres, formerly owned by George Mitchell. This farm was uncultivated, and he made his own improvements upon it. Mr. Cameron was an enterprising man and took an active interest in the progress of the Democratic party; he was also interested in educational mat-ters, having frequently served as a school director in the township. In religion he was a member of the Presbyterian Church at Washington.
